Tegna Snaps Gun Violence Reporting Out Of Its Fog
Collaborating journalists at eight Tegna stations across the country took a deeper look at gun violence to reclaim a signal out of crime reporting’s usual noise. The result, 7 Days, 1,000 Shootings, charts a path to more impactful local journalism on the epidemic.
